Mas Sawai Cluster involving oil palm plantation in Subis registers 144 new Covid-19 cases so far


By Adrian Lim

KUCHING, Aug 24: The Mas Sawai Cluster stemming from an oil palm plantation in Subis with 129 confirmed positive cases today is the cluster registering the most number of cases in Sarawak.

According to Sarawak Disaster Management Committee’s (SDMC) daily report on Covid-19, following the additional 129 cases, the cumulative number of confirmed Covid-19 cases for the cluster has increased to 144.


As of today, to control the further spread of the Mas Sawai Cluster, a total of 295 people have been swabbed while 151 people are awaiting the results of their Covid-19 swab tests.

The Mas Sawai Cluster was declared yesterday after 15 individuals from an oil palm plantation being found to be positive for Covid-19.

Meanwhile, the Long Urun cluster in the interior of Belaga added 49 new Covid-19 cases, bringing cumulative cases for the cluster to 535.

A total of 871 longhouse residents have been swabbed while 109 people are awaiting the results of their Covid-19 swab tests.

The cluster was identified last Friday (August 20) after 79 longhouse residents in Belaga tested positive for Covid-19 where subsequently, more new cases emerge on daily basis.

SDMC said Bungey 2 Cluster, identified following an outbreak after a a wedding ceremony in Betong last month, produced another 47 Covid-19 cases, adding to the cumulative cases for the cluster to 409.
